On 3 June 2026, an online workshop entitled “Developing AI Use Cases for Higher Education” was held for academic staff and students of Berdyansk State Pedagogical University.

The workshop was facilitated by invited experts from Germany, Stefanie Go and Kathrin Schelling, whose research focuses on the integration of artificial intelligence technologies into educational practice. Stefanie Go is a researcher and lecturer at Bielefeld University. Within her PhD project, she explores how students and educators can participate in the design and use of AI-enhanced learning environments. Kathrin Schelling is a freelance copywriter, editor, and PhD researcher whose work examines the needs and expectations of students and educators as users of AI-based educational technologies.

During the session, participants explored the fundamental principles of large language models (LLMs) and discussed key strategies for effective prompt design, including clearly defining objectives, providing context, breaking complex tasks into sequential steps, and assigning a specific role to the language model. Particular attention was given to the limitations of universal prompt collections and the reasons why they often fail to address the actual needs of educators and students. Different educational contexts, disciplines, and learning objectives require tailored AI use cases rather than generic solutions.

In the practical part of the workshop, participants worked with the Scenario Mapping methodology, which involves five steps:

  1. Describing a learning situation;
  2. Defining educational objectives;
  3. Identifying stages where AI can provide value;
  4. Analysing potential implications of AI use;
  5. Developing initial prompts for the selected scenario.

The workshop provided a platform for sharing experiences and developing competencies related to the responsible use of generative AI. Participants discussed how contemporary digital tools can be applied thoughtfully and purposefully in alignment with pedagogical goals and the real needs of the university community.
